Monte Carlo simulation is a computational technique used to model and analyze complex systems or processes through repeated random sampling. It involves generating multiple simulated scenarios or iterations of a system by sampling from probability distributions of input variables, performing computations or simulations based on these samples, and aggregating the results to estimate outcomes or assess risks. Monte Carlo simulation allows analysts to account for uncertainty, variability, and randomness in decision-making, simulate alternative scenarios, and quantify the likelihood of different outcomes under various conditions.
